The Damietta Furniture City Company will complete and being operating its 331-feddan furniture manufacturing complex by 2022, company CEO El Moataz Bahaa El Din said. The project is a 20-minute drive from downtown Damietta, and will include 150 furniture factories, some 1500 smaller workshops, exposition halls, banks, hotels and other facilities.
